We came here on recommendation from a friend who has lived here for 20+ years. She said to sit in the bar area to eat food. Since we were starving we ordered 3 appetizers to share. All of the food was delicious! Escargot: It is in the shell and they give you the tongs to hold them and take out the meat. The sauce was nice and garlicky like it should be! Octopus: It was prepared very well. The different sauces on the bottom complimented it well as did the well seasoned and cooked shrimp that came on it! Really enjoyed it! Mushroom Risotto: The poached egg on top added a nice extra creamy and savory note. The sauce was perfect and not too salty. I really enjoyed it! (The one vegetable I do not like is peas, there were quite a few but it did not distract from the taste and my boyfriend who loves them really enjoyed it) Bread: Really tasty and they baked garlic cloves into it. That made it perfect to use if the sauce from the escargot! Service: Very good! The food came fast and they were all very friendly!

AWESOME! I went her for a special dinner with my dad. We had a FABULOUS meal and a GREAT time. Awesome Bordeaux wines. Don't bother with the super expensive ones either. The lower priced ones must have been very carefully selected because they were ABSOLUTELY OUTSTANDING! I love love love good Bordeaux wines too! Lagostina gnocchi was embarrassingly licking the sauce up of the plate delicious. The fish I had was cooked to perfection - my dad's said his lamb chops were great. Heirloom tomato salad = must try. How do they even get such good tomatoes in Steamboat in the dead of winter? Actually, scratch that. Who cares? Just order them! Not a morsel of food or a drop of sauce left on our plates. Harwigs isn't inexpensive but well worth the money for a special dinner or if you are in the mood for some bomb ass French food! And if you are skiing on a vacation what's an extra hundo? That's the cost of ONE lift ticket on the mountain. And you worked hard skiing in the champagne powder. You deserve it.
